好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

多代理系统协调机制研究-全面剖析.docx

29页
  • 卖家[上传人]:永***
  • 文档编号:599692484
  • 上传时间:2025-03-17
  • 文档格式:DOCX
  • 文档大小:40.13KB
  • / 29 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 多代理系统协调机制研究 第一部分 多代理系统定义与特性 2第二部分 系统协调机制分类与比较 5第三部分 协调策略设计原则与要求 9第四部分 协调协议设计与实现 12第五部分 协调性能评估方法与指标 15第六部分 现有协调机制存在的问题分析 19第七部分 未来研究方向与技术挑战 21第八部分 应用案例分析与经验总结 25第一部分 多代理系统定义与特性关键词关键要点多代理系统定义与特性1. 多代理系统是一种由多个自治代理组成的分布式系统2. 每个代理拥有自己的知识、能力和责任域,能够独立执行任务3. 代理之间通过交互和协同工作以达成系统目标代理自治性1. 代理具有独立决策的能力,不需要人类操作员的直接干预2. 自治性确保系统能够应对复杂和不确定的环境3. 代理可以通过学习、推理和适应来优化自身的行为代理交互与协作1. 代理之间的交互通常通过通信协议和消息传递机制进行2. 协作机制允许代理共同解决复杂问题,实现资源共享和任务分配3. 协调算法确保代理间的协同工作高效且一致知识与能力共享1. 多代理系统中的知识共享有助于提高整个系统的认知能力和学习效率2. 能力共享允许代理根据需要将任务委托给其他代理,以平衡负载和利用专业能力。

      3. 共享机制需要确保信息安全和代理间的信任关系多代理系统的应用场景1. 多代理系统广泛应用于智能供应链管理、智能交通系统、资源分配和分布式控制系统2. 这些应用需要复杂的代理协同和资源优化机制3. 通过多代理系统,可以实现更高效、灵活和自适应的解决方案多代理系统的挑战与机遇1. 多代理系统的挑战包括复杂性管理、代理间的互操作性、安全和隐私保护等2. 机遇在于可以利用代理间的协同作用来解决传统系统难以处理的问题3. 随着人工智能和机器学习技术的进步,多代理系统有望实现更多创新应用多代理系统(Multi-Agent Systems, MAS)是一种分布式系统,它由多个自主的、智能的代理(agents)组成,这些代理能够独立地进行决策,并与环境、其他代理进行交互代理通常具有自己的目标和能力,但它们也可能需要与其他代理协作以达成共同的目标多代理系统的定义与特性可以从以下几个方面进行阐述:1. 自主性:多代理系统中的每个代理都是一个自主的实体,它们拥有自己的知识、能力和意愿代理可以独立地做出决策,并根据自身的目标和能力与环境进行交互自主性是多代理系统的一个关键特性,因为它允许代理根据不同的环境和情况灵活地调整其行为。

      2. 交互性:代理之间的交互是多代理系统的重要组成部分这些交互可以是直接的,如代理之间的通信和协作;也可以是间接的,如通过共享资源或环境变化来影响其他代理代理之间的交互可以是同步的,也可以是异步的,这取决于系统的设计和代理的行为模式3. 协作性:在多代理系统中,代理可能需要协作以完成复杂任务或共同目标协作可以是自愿的,也可以是强制的,这取决于代理之间的相互关系和系统设计协作机制是多代理系统的一个重要方面,因为它涉及到如何协调代理的活动,以确保共同目标的达成4. 知识共享:多代理系统中的代理可能需要共享信息和知识以支持决策过程和协作知识共享可以是显式的,如通过对话或信息传输;也可以是隐式的,如通过观察其他代理的行为或环境变化有效的知识共享机制对于提高系统的整体性能和智能水平至关重要5. 适应性:多代理系统需要能够适应不断变化的环境和新的挑战适应性涉及代理的自我调整和重新配置,以应对环境变化或系统需求的变化这通常需要代理具有学习能力和动态适应能力6. 可扩展性:多代理系统应该能够轻松地扩展,以包括更多的代理或适应新的功能可扩展性意味着系统设计应能够处理代理数量的变化和新的代理加入,同时保持系统的稳定性和效率。

      7. 安全性:在多代理系统中,代理之间的交互可能涉及敏感信息因此,安全性是一个重要的考虑因素,需要设计安全协议和机制来保护代理的数据和通信,防止未授权访问和恶意攻击多代理系统在许多领域都有应用,包括智能交通系统、供应链管理、复杂问题求解、自动化控制系统等随着人工智能和云计算技术的发展,多代理系统也面临着新的挑战和机遇未来的研究将集中在如何提高系统的协同效率,如何更好地集成人工智能技术以增强代理的决策能力,以及如何确保系统的可靠性和安全性第二部分 系统协调机制分类与比较关键词关键要点分布式协调机制1. 基于任务分配的协调方法,如工作流管理系统2. 分布式共识算法,如区块链技术中的工作量证明(Proof of Work)和权益证明(Proof of Stake)3. 分布式网络中的路由协议,如BGP协议和DHT(分布式散列表)算法多智能体学习协调1. 强化学习框架,如Q-learning和Actor-Critic算法,用于智能体之间的策略学习2. 博弈论和机制设计,为智能体间的合作与竞争提供理论基础3. 多智能体系统中的奖励分配和惩罚机制,以激励智能体遵循协调策略事件驱动协调1. 事件触发机制,根据代理间的交互或环境变化动态调整协调过程。

      2. 事件过滤和事件检测技术,以减少不必要的信息交换3. 事件响应策略,如应急预案和故障恢复机制,以应对突发事件基于规则的协调1. 规则引擎和逻辑编程,用于定义和执行协调规则2. 规则库的动态更新和知识更新,以适应系统变化和环境变化3. 规则解释和规则验证,以确保协调机制的透明度和可靠性基于代理的协调1. 代理协商和代理代理之间的沟通机制,如拍卖和讨价还价策略2. 代理间的信任和信誉管理,以促进长期合作关系3. 代理策略的多样性,通过进化算法和遗传算法进行策略进化同步与异步协调1. 同步协调机制,如消息队列和锁机制,确保数据的完整性和一致性2. 异步协调机制,如发布订阅模式和无锁机制,提高系统性能和响应速度3. 同步与异步协调的转换策略,根据系统负载和任务特性动态调整协调模式多代理系统(Multi-agent Systems, MAS)是由多个自主的、智能的代理人(agents)组成,它们可以在不同的环境中相互协作以解决复杂问题在这些系统中,协调机制是确保代理人群体能够有效地共同工作并达成共同目标的机制系统协调机制的研究主要集中在设计能够实现信息共享、资源分配、任务分配、冲突解决等任务的协调策略。

      系统协调机制可以分为几类,包括:1. 自上而下协调机制(Centralized Coordination Mechanism):在这种机制中,有一个中央协调者负责管理和控制所有代理人的行为中央协调者通常拥有全局信息,能够做出全局最优决策自上而下协调机制的优点是易于实现,中央协调者可以快速做出决策并确保系统整体效率然而,随着系统规模的扩大,中央协调者可能无法处理所有信息,导致响应速度变慢2. 自下而上协调机制(Decentralized Coordination Mechanism):在这种机制中,没有中央协调者,每个代理人都有自己的决策权代理人通过相互通信和协调来达成目标自下而上协调机制的优点是能够适应动态变化的系统环境,并且易于扩展然而,它可能需要更高的通信开销,并且可能存在协调失败的风险3. 混合协调机制(Hybrid Coordination Mechanism):混合协调机制结合了自上而下和自下而上协调机制的优点在这种机制中,中央协调者负责处理全局问题,而局部问题则由代理人自行解决混合协调机制能够平衡全局控制和局部自治,提高系统的灵活性和效率4. 竞争与合作协调机制(Competition and Cooperation Coordination Mechanism):在这种机制中,代理人可以同时进行竞争和合作。

      竞争可以是代理人之间的对抗,以获得资源或完成任务合作则是代理人之间为了共同目标而协同工作竞争与合作协调机制允许系统动态适应环境变化,并且在某些情况下可以提高系统的整体性能5. 启发式协调机制(Heuristic Coordination Mechanism):启发式协调机制是基于经验法则或启发式规则的协调策略这些策略没有严格的数学证明,但通常简单且易于实现启发式协调机制在某些情况下可以提供满意解,但可能在其他情况下表现不佳6. 基于规则的协调机制(Rule-Based Coordination Mechanism):基于规则的协调机制是基于一组预定义的规则来指导代理人的行为这些规则可以描述如何响应特定事件或如何与其他代理人进行交互基于规则的协调机制易于理解和实现,但可能无法适应复杂的动态环境7. 基于演化的协调机制(Evolutionary Coordination Mechanism):在这种机制中,协调策略是通过进化算法(如遗传算法)来优化的进化协调机制可以自动学习和适应环境变化,但可能需要大量的计算资源8. 基于协商的协调机制(Negotiation-Based Coordination Mechanism):在这种机制中,代理人通过协商来达成共识。

      协商可以是基于规则的,也可以是多阶段的,涉及代理人之间的多次交互基于协商的协调机制能够处理复杂的交互和冲突,但可能需要长时间的协商过程综上所述,系统协调机制的研究是一个多方面的领域,涉及算法设计、通信协议、策略优化等不同的协调机制适用于不同的系统环境和需求未来的研究可能会集中在如何结合多种协调机制的优势,以及如何设计更加高效、自适应的协调策略第三部分 协调策略设计原则与要求关键词关键要点多代理系统协调策略设计原则与要求1. 最小协调原则:协调策略应尽可能减少不必要的交互,以降低通信开销和复杂性2. 鲁棒性:策略应能够应对代理间的故障和网络中断,确保系统稳定性3. 效率性:协调过程应尽可能高效,以减少整体执行时间和资源消耗多代理系统建模与仿真1. 语义建模:确保模型能够准确表达代理和环境的行为及交互2. 动态性:模型应能够捕捉代理系统在不同时间点的状态和行为3. 验证性:通过仿真验证模型的正确性和协调策略的有效性多代理系统通信协议与机制1. 可靠性:通信协议应保证消息的可靠传输,避免数据丢失或重复2. 安全性:协议应提供数据保密性和完整性保护,防止信息泄露或篡改3. 可扩展性:协议设计应考虑系统未来扩展性,支持新代理加入或旧代理退出。

      多代理系统性能评估与优化1. 性能指标:确定用于评估系统性能的关键指标,如响应时间、资源利用率等2. 优化算法:开发优化算法以调整协调策略,以提高整体性能3. 实验验证:通过实验验证优化效果,确保策略在实际应用中的有效性多代理系统学习与适应性1. 学习机制:设计学习算法,使得代理能够根据环境变化调整行为2. 适应性策略:创建能够适应系统内部和外部环境变化的策略3. 学习:实现实时学习能力,使系统能够动态调整协调策略多代理系统安全与隐私保护1. 安全策略:制定策略以防止恶意代理对系统的攻击,保护系统免受网络威胁2. 隐私保护:设计机制以保护代理数据和行为的隐私性,防止未授权的访问和泄露。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.